What does Hydrolyzed Adansonia Digitata Seed Extract do in a cosmetic formula?

This ingredient primarily functions as a skin and hair conditioning agent, adding light humectancy and a soft film-forming effect. In hair care, it can help improve feel, manageability, and perceived smoothness.

Is Hydrolyzed Adansonia Digitata Seed Extract clean?

This ingredient is generally well aligned with clean-beauty standards because it is plant-derived, low in typical irritation concern, and not a common restricted-list material. The main quality check is preservation and residual processing aids, since hydrolyzed botanical materials are usually supplied in water-based blends.

Is Hydrolyzed Adansonia Digitata Seed Extract sustainable?

This material comes from a renewable botanical source and is often made from a plant fraction that can sit alongside food or oil supply chains. It is expected to be biodegradable, with sourcing quality tied to traceability, local harvesting practices, and fair supplier relationships.

Is Hydrolyzed Adansonia Digitata Seed Extract COSMOS-approved?

It is generally compatible with COSMOS-natural and COSMOS-organic when the source, hydrolysis process, solvents, and preservation system meet the standard. From a Green Chemistry view, it fits well when produced by water-based or enzymatic hydrolysis with minimal processing residues.

How does Hydrolyzed Adansonia Digitata Seed Extract work chemically?

This material is a water-soluble mixture of hydrolyzed botanical macromolecules, typically including peptides, amino acids, sugars, and polyphenolic fragments rather than a single molecule. Typical use levels are often around 0.1% to 5%, and it is usually formulated in the mildly acidic to neutral pH range where most skin and hair products sit.
